    1. Hyper-Personalization Driven by Advanced AI

    Artificial Intelligence (AI) will move beyond basic recommendations to offer truly hyper-personalized experiences. In 2025, AI will analyze vast datasets, including user behavior, preferences, biometric data, and even emotional responses, to predict individual needs with unprecedented accuracy. For the fashion industry, this means AI-powered stylists offering bespoke outfit suggestions based on weather, event, personal style, and even mood. Virtual try-on technologies will become indistinguishable from reality, making online shopping more engaging and reducing returns.

    Example: AI systems that generate unique clothing patterns or accessory designs tailored to an individual's specific body measurements and aesthetic preferences, which can then be 3D printed or manufactured on demand.     2. Sustainable Technologies and Circular Economies

    With growing environmental concerns, sustainable innovations will be paramount. This trend encompasses everything from renewable energy storage and carbon capture technologies to advancements in biodegradable materials and circular design principles. In fashion, this translates to the widespread adoption of bio-fabricated textiles (e.g., mushroom leather, lab-grown silk), advanced recycling processes for garments, and supply chains optimized for minimal waste. Blockchain technology will play a crucial role in ensuring transparency and traceability of sustainable practices.

    Example: Garments designed for disassembly and recycling, with embedded RFID tags to track their lifecycle and facilitate material recovery. Companies using algae or bacteria to create new dyes or fibers.     3. The Pervasiveness of Wearable Technology

    Wearable tech will become more seamlessly integrated into everyday life, offering enhanced functionality without sacrificing aesthetics. Beyond smartwatches, expect to see smart clothing with embedded sensors for health monitoring, performance tracking, and even environmental interaction. These devices will provide real-time data, enabling proactive health management and personalized experiences. For fashion 2025, this means 'smart fabrics' that adapt to temperature, light up, or display dynamic patterns, blurring the lines between clothing and gadget.

    Example: Athletic wear that monitors vital signs and muscle activity, providing real-time coaching feedback. Fashionable accessories that integrate augmented reality displays or haptic feedback for notifications.     5. Advanced Robotics and Automation

    Robotics will see significant advancements in dexterity, AI integration, and collaborative capabilities. In manufacturing, highly agile robots will streamline production processes, making customized, on-demand manufacturing more feasible and cost-effective. This impacts the fashion supply chain by enabling faster turnaround times, reducing labor costs, and improving quality control, especially for complex tasks currently requiring skilled human hands.

    Example: Robotic arms that can precisely sew intricate patterns or assemble delicate garments, working alongside human operators in smart factories. Automated warehouses managed by fleets of intelligent robots for efficient inventory and dispatch.     6. Edge Computing and Decentralized Networks

    The shift from centralized cloud computing to edge computing will accelerate, bringing data processing closer to the source. This reduces latency, enhances security, and enables faster decision-making, crucial for real-time applications like autonomous vehicles, smart cities, and advanced IoT devices. For fashion tech, this means faster processing for smart mirrors, instant data analysis from wearable sensors, and more responsive in-store digital experiences without relying on constant cloud connectivity.

    Example: Smart retail stores where edge devices process customer movements and interactions locally to provide immediate personalized recommendations or assistance.     9. Advanced Data Analytics and Predictive Modeling

    The ability to collect, analyze, and interpret large datasets will become even more sophisticated, enabling highly accurate predictive modeling. This will transform everything from supply chain optimization and demand forecasting to personalized marketing campaigns. In fashion, predictive analytics will forecast trend cycles, optimize inventory management to reduce waste, and enable designers to create collections that resonate with future consumer tastes.

    Example: Algorithms that analyze social media sentiment, sales data, and economic indicators to predict the popularity of specific colors or styles six months in advance.     10. Human-Centric AI and Ethical Technology

    As AI becomes more powerful, the focus will shift towards developing human-centric AI that prioritizes ethical considerations, fairness, privacy, and user well-being. This includes explainable AI (XAI) that provides transparency in decision-making, and AI systems designed with built-in safeguards against bias and misuse. For the tech and fashion industries, this means ensuring AI algorithms used for personalization or trend prediction are free from biases, and that data privacy is rigorously protected, fostering trust and responsible innovation.

    Example: AI tools used in recruitment or lending that include mechanisms to identify and correct biases against certain demographic groups. Fashion recommendation engines that are transparent about how they derive suggestions and allow users to fine-tune their preferences easily.
